AR Technology Applications
Augmented reality is a technology that superimposes computer-generated images on top of the real world. The most common use of this technology is to overlay digital information on top of the view from a camera or other sensor, such as GPS data. For example, you can see your car's location and speed in an app running on your smartphone. You can also get directions to a restaurant using Google Maps or Waze (the latter uses both augmented reality and virtual reality). In addition to these basic applications, there are many more creative applications for AR today: 3D modeling programs let you create objects out of blocks; games let you move around virtual worlds; video conferencing lets all parties see each other while they talk; and so much more!
